The brain perceives motion through our eyes. Light enters the eye through the pupil which is received by receptor cells in the retina. These receptor cells then send signals to the brain. The brain gets a snapshot of this image every 100msec. If the snapshot is identical, then no motion is perceived. If there is motion, the images will differ and the brain interprets the movement.
